The Role of Statistics and Analytics in Sports Betting

ilanb     September 26, 2023
Sports betting

In the fast-paced world of sports betting, success often hinges on more than just gut feelings or lucky guesses. The role of statistics and analytics has become increasingly vital for sports bettors looking to gain an edge. In this article, we’ll explore how statistics and analytics can empower sports enthusiasts to make informed betting decisions and maximize their winnings.

Understanding the Power of Data:

Data-driven decision-making is at the heart of sports betting. Statistics and analytics provide a treasure trove of information, from player performance metrics to historical team data and trends. Here’s how you can harness this power:

Performance Analysis

1. Player and Team Performance Analysis: Dive deep into player and team statistics. Evaluate factors like player form, scoring averages, defensive strengths, and historical head-to-head performance. Analyzing these data points can help you identify underdogs with the potential to upset favorites.

Injuries in sports

2. Injuries and Roster Changes: Keep a close eye on injury reports and roster changes. Injuries to key players can have a significant impact on a team’s performance. Analytics can help you assess how these changes may affect the outcome of a game.

Home ground advantage

3. Home Field Advantage: Analyze the historical performance of teams on their home turf. Home-field advantage can be a game-changer, and statistics can reveal which teams tend to excel in front of their fans.

Weather and playing conditions

4. Weather and Playing Conditions: Statistics can provide insights into how weather conditions may affect the outcome of outdoor sports. Certain teams or players may perform better or worse under specific weather conditions.

Historical trends in sports

5. Historical Trends and Patterns: Examine historical trends and patterns in team performance. For instance, does a particular team tend to perform better in the second half of the season? Are they more successful against certain opponents?

Actionable Tips for Betting on Underdogs:

Now, let’s focus on how you can use statistics and analytics to bet on underdogs strategically and potentially increase your winnings:

1. Identify Value Bets: Statistical analysis can help you identify underdogs that are undervalued by bookmakers. Look for teams or players with strong historical performance against their upcoming opponents, even if they’re considered underdogs.

2. Comparative Analysis: Compare the statistical profiles of underdogs and favorites. Are there areas where the underdog excels or has a competitive edge? Betting on underdogs with statistical advantages can be a smart move.

3. Regression to the Mean: Analyze whether a team’s recent poor performance is due to temporary setbacks or if there are underlying factors that suggest they are due for a turnaround. Statistical regression analysis can help you spot potential upsets.

4. Betting on the Spread: Instead of betting on the underdog to win outright, consider betting on the spread. If the underdog is expected to lose but not by a significant margin, this type of bet can still yield a win even if the underdog doesn’t win the game.
5. In-Play Betting Opportunities: Utilize live statistical data for in-play betting. Watch the game and monitor real-time statistics to identify momentum shifts or opportunities to place strategic bets on the underdog during the match.
